C++ has incomplete type
WebC++98 class members of incomplete type were not prohibited if an object of the class type was never created non-static class data members need to be complete CWG 977: …WebThe error means that you try and add a member to the struct of a type that isn't fully defined yet, so the compiler cannot know its size in order to determine the objects …
C++ has incomplete type
Did you know?
WebMay 21, 2024 · If you set your loggingLevel to "Debug" and then open the file, you should see the paths we use after "sending compilation args" in the C/C++ section of the Output pane. It's probably best to wait till 0.17.2 to be released …WebMar 29, 2016 · To fix it, you have to modify the library. Go into the folder TFT/src/utility/ and make a copy of Adafruit_GFX.h, calling it PImage.cpp. Open Adafruit_GFX.h and delete …
WebJul 10, 2024 · If it has been defined, then the type exists and is complete. If it has been declared but not defined, then the type exists and is incomplete. If it has been neither declared nor defined, the act of writing struct special serves as a declaration! This puts us back into case 2 above, and the type exists and is incomplete.WebAug 2, 2024 · An incomplete type is a type that describes an identifier but lacks information needed to determine the size of the identifier. An incomplete type can be: A structure …
WebAug 25, 2015 · A class that has been declared but not defined, an enumeration type in certain contexts, or an array of unknown size or of incomplete element type, is an incompletely-defined object type. Incompletely-defined object types and the void types are incomplete types. Objects shall not be defined to have an incomplete type.Webclass-key - one of class, struct and union.The keywords class and struct are identical except for the default member access and the default base class access.If it is union, the …
#include
WebApr 6, 2024 · Note: C++ has no concept of compatible types. A C program that declares two types that are compatible but not identical in different translation units is not a valid C++ … myjewellery content creatorWebIncomplete class declarations. (C++ only) An incomplete class declaration is a class declaration that does not define any class members. You cannot declare any objects of …old ardboe lyricsWeb我有以下有效的代碼: 但是當我編寫以下內容時,它不起作用: 完整的錯誤信息: adsbygoogle window.adsbygoogle .push 我想我可以嘗試在不使用 for 循環的情況下重寫eXX並通過它,但這也行不通。 另外,我讀到有人建議添加類似 include lt MatrixFuold archtop guitarWebArray types of incomplete element type are also incomplete types. The possibly constrained (since C++20) auto specifier can be used as array element type in the declaration of a pointer or reference to array, which deduces the element type from the initializer or the function argument (since C++14) , e.g. auto ( * p ) [ 42 ] = & a ; is valid if ...old army email loginsWebNov 30, 2016 · 1 Answer. The class isn't fully defined until that closing brace. Before that you can't define objects of the class. A major reason is that the size of the object isn't …my jewellery fashionchequeWebI need to call insert_or_assign like this: found = m_cache.insert_or_assign(found, query_data, std::make_pair(std::chrono::steady_clock::now(), json::parse(res.body()))); .found is an iterator and I'm using it to see if the data I need is in there and if it's not an hour old (assuming it's in there); if it's not there or if it's an hour old, this function will make a …myjewellery email old aredite